Dot Net Full Stack
The increasing demand for dynamic and responsive web applications has brought the role of full-stack developers to the forefront of the software industry. Among the many full-stack technology stacks available, DotNet Full Stack development stands out due to its robustness, scalability, and deep integration with enterprise-grade applications. Canada, being a technologically progressive country, has become a hub for software development and IT training. Professionals and students alike are seeking DotNet Full Stack Classes in Canada to leverage these opportunities and grow in the ever-expanding digital economy.
The DotNet Full Stack development environment supports both client-side and server-side development, with technologies such as ASP.NET, C#, SQL Server, JavaScript, HTML, CSS, and front-end frameworks like Angular or React. Mastery of these technologies enables developers to autonomously construct, deploy, and manage full web applications, increasing productivity and lowering development costs. The demand for DotNet Full Stack developers in Canada has increased in industries such as banking, healthcare, retail, and government IT projects.
Overview of DotNet Full Stack Development
The term "DotNet Full Stack" refers to the development of both the front-end (client side) and back-end (server side) of web applications utilising the Microsoft.NET framework. On the backend, developers use ASP.NET Core, C#, and Microsoft SQL Server. These technologies provide server logic, data management, and APIs. On the front end, developers use modern web standards like as HTML5, CSS3, and JavaScript, as well as frameworks like Angular, React, and Blazor.
C# is the principal language used in the.NET framework and is renowned for its type safety, performance, and versatility. ASP.NET Core is an open-source, cross-platform framework that enables the development of high-performance web applications. When combined with client-side technology, it fully enables developers to create single-page applications (SPAs), enterprise web portals, and integrated RESTful services.
This unified approach streamlines the application architecture while improving maintainability, security, and speed. The environment is ideal for cloud-based development, especially with Azure, which allows for smooth deployment and scalability.
Importance of DotNet Full Stack Training in Canada
In Canada, the technology landscape is rapidly transforming with more enterprises moving to digital platforms. Organizations are actively seeking versatile developers who can handle both front-end and back-end development efficiently. This is why enrolling in SevenMentor’s DotNet Full Stack courses in Canada has become essential for those aspiring to enter or upskill in the software development industry.
The training programs are structured to address the industry’s growing needs by combining theoretical concepts with practical implementation. Learners are introduced to object-oriented programming in C#, database management with SQL Server, API development with ASP.NET Core, front-end design with Angular or React, and project deployment using DevOps pipelines.
The job market in cities like Toronto, Vancouver, Montreal, and Calgary shows a high demand for .NET professionals who understand full-stack architecture. Government digital transformation programs, fintech expansion, and startup ecosystems contribute to this demand. Therefore, acquiring professional skills through DotNet Full Stack training in Canada is a strategic career move.
Curriculum Coverage in DotNet Full Stack Classes
A standard DotNet Full Stack training program in Canada is rigorously planned to ensure comprehensive learning and industrial readiness. Students begin by studying C# programming foundations, including object-oriented techniques, data structures, and exception handling. The curriculum then progresses to ASP.NET MVC and ASP.NET Core, with a focus on developing scalable back-end services.
Front-end development requires skills in HTML5, CSS3, JavaScript, and a popular framework such as Angular. This enables learners to construct interactive and dynamic interfaces. Furthermore, integration with RESTful APIs and JSON data handling are taught to provide seamless communication between client and server.
Database management is addressed using Microsoft SQL Server, including advanced querying, indexing, stored procedures, and normalization techniques. Students also learn how to manage version control using Git and GitHub. The final stages of the course include practical projects, debugging techniques, testing strategies, deployment methods, and continuous integration practices.
Each module is reinforced with live projects, assignments, and case studies to provide learners with real-world application experience. Hands-on exposure ensures that learners not only understand the concepts but are capable of implementing them in live production environments.
Real-world Applications of DotNet Full Stack Development
DotNet Full Stack developers in Canada play a crucial role in building and maintaining enterprise-grade applications. From government portals and educational platforms to healthcare management systems and online banking interfaces, the scope of DotNet technologies is vast.
For instance, many Canadian banks use .NET-based infrastructures for their secure and performance-critical online banking services. Similarly, provincial health departments rely on custom applications developed in .NET for managing patient records, appointment scheduling, and public health reporting. Retailers use .NET for building scalable e-commerce platforms and inventory management tools.
DotNet Full Stack developers can work on diverse projects like ERP systems, CRM platforms, AI-powered dashboards, and IoT-based web services. These opportunities offer not only career growth but also provide exposure to multidisciplinary industries, making the profile highly valuable in the job market.
Career Prospects After DotNet Full Stack Training
Completing DotNet Full Stack Classes in Canada opens doors to several lucrative career paths. Some of the common job roles include Full Stack Developer, .NET Developer, Back-End Developer, Front-End Engineer, Software Engineer, Web Developer, and Application Developer.
Employers are looking for developers who are familiar with full-stack architecture, project workflows, software development lifecycles (SDLC), and version control systems. Proficiency with DotNet technologies gives you an advantage in interviews and performance reviews, especially for employment in agile development teams and DevOps environments.
DotNet Full Stack developers in Canada may expect to earn between CAD 60,000 and CAD 110,000 per year, depending on experience and expertise. With emerging technologies such as Blazor, WebAssembly, and cloud-native.NET applications, there is always room for growth and development in this industry.
About SevenMentor
SevenMentor the best training institute for DotNet Full Stack Training, stands out due to its industry-aligned curriculum, experienced instructors, and hands-on teaching methodology. The training program at SevenMentor is curated by professionals with deep experience in the software industry and focuses on creating job-ready candidates.
What makes SevenMentor distinct is its emphasis on practical exposure. The institute offers real-time project assignments, resume-building workshops, interview preparation sessions, and continuous evaluation to track student progress. Their labs are equipped with the latest tools and frameworks necessary for full-stack development.
The training modules are updated regularly to include the latest features in ASP.NET Core, C# enhancements, new front-end libraries, and cloud integrations. This ensures that students are learning current and in-demand skills rather than outdated technologies.
Students also benefit from career services such as internship opportunities, placement drives, and referrals to top software companies in Canada. The institute maintains industry connections that facilitate employment in top-tier IT firms, consultancies, and software development companies across the country.
Project-based Learning and Capstone Integration
One of the core aspects of the training at SevenMentor is project-based learning. Each module culminates in a mini-project which is part of a final capstone project. These projects simulate real-world software development scenarios. From building e-commerce sites to implementing REST APIs and configuring databases for multi-tenant platforms, students gain hands-on experience.
Capstone projects are reviewed by experts and assessed for code quality, functionality, and design. Students are encouraged to use best practices such as clean code architecture, MVC patterns, reusable components, and automated testing. These exercises help learners transition smoothly from training to employment.
Pursuing DotNet Full Stack courses in Canada empowers students and working professionals to contribute effectively in both startup and enterprise environments. The blend of back-end and front-end development expertise enables candidates to build end-to-end applications, reduce project delivery timelines, and ensure efficient software architecture.
Choosing SevenMentor the best training institute for DotNet Full Stack Training ensures that learners receive not just education but a pathway to meaningful employment and professional growth. Whether one is entering the tech industry or seeking to upskill, DotNet Full Stack training offers a solid foundation and a wide range of career opportunities.
Online Classes
SevenMentor offers comprehensive online DotNet Full Stack classes. The virtual classes are conducted by certified trainers and include real-time interaction, hands-on labs, code walkthroughs, and live project work. Students get access to recorded sessions, discussion forums, and 24/7 support. The curriculum is the same as the in-class program and includes continuous assessments to ensure learning outcomes are met.
This format is especially helpful for working professionals, international students, or those residing in remote areas of Canada. With the flexibility to learn at their own pace, students can balance their professional commitments while acquiring new skills. The online course offers the same placement support and project-based learning as the classroom training.
Corporate Training
SevenMentor also offers corporate DotNet Full Stack training solutions tailored to organizational needs. Companies looking to upskill their in-house development teams can partner with SevenMentor for custom-designed training programs. These training sessions can be delivered on-site or virtually, based on client preferences.
The curriculum is adapted to meet the specific technology stacks, legacy system upgrades, or project requirements of the organization. Corporate learners receive hands-on exercises, practical code samples, and post-training support for smoother implementation in live projects. The corporate training model has been successfully deployed in various enterprises across Canada, particularly in banking, insurance, and e-governance sectors.
SevenMentor ensures that corporate training delivers measurable results. Partnering with SevenMentor, the best training institute for DotNet Full Stack Training, provides businesses with a scalable and sustainable workforce development solution.